New: self-managed VPS hosting at tsoHost

Three letters have been on everyone’s lips at tsoHost this week – VPS.

We’ve just launched a brand-new collection of self-managed VPS products.

These VPS plans give you dedicated resources without you having to splash out on a dedicated server.

They’ve been designed for the likes of system admins, web developers, experienced web designers and those who know their way around a virtual private server.

In particular, this sort of hosting is ideal for anyone who offers design or development services to a portfolio of clients, those who run resource intensive or high traffic websites and apps, and those who need more flexibility when it comes to configuring a server.

There are six plans to choose from, featuring between one and 16 CPUs, 40 to 800GB of storage, and up to 64GB of RAM.

They’re highly tailorable, too. You can choose operating systems, add control panels and pick between standard and high RAM plans.

With one vCPU, 2GB RAM and 40GB storage, the first-tier plan is spot on for anyone who feels they have outgrown shared hosting and wants to make their first transition to a VPS product.

Plus, whether you start out with the first-tier plan or the more powerful options, you’ve got room to grow. Should you need more resources, you can upgrade to the next plan up in a single click.

The top 10 highlights of our new VPS offering

Build the exact server you need

There are six plans to choose from, but these can be configured in more than 40 different ways – add a control panel like cPanel or Plesk. Switch to a high RAM plan. Choose Windows over Linux and so on.

Root access

There are two main benefits to root access. The first is flexibility – install the exact applications that you need. The second is efficiency – if you know your SSH commands, you can carry out server admin faster than you can say ‘server admin’.

Performance monitoring

These plans allow you to put your server’s performance under a microscope. We’ll send you emails about any issues that may impact on your server’s efficiency, such as high resource usage and outages.

99.9% uptime

The performance monitoring alerts included in these plans should give you a certain degree of peace of mind. We top that up with our 99.9% uptime guarantee. Our network is monitored 24/7 and we have steadfast security such as DDoS protection firmly in place.

VPS support

If you need help restarting or rebuilding your server, you can direct your questions to a member of support team. 

Free backups

Automated weekly backups are included in the price of all these plans, so you have one less thing to think about.

One click upgrades

You can be as ambitious as you want to be with these plans. If you find yourself taking on a new project or new clients that require more resources, just upgrade your plan in a single click.

Global data centres

Choose a data centre that best suits your business. Pick from locations in Europe, North America or Asia Pacific to ensure your clients get the best page load speeds for them.

No noisy neighbors

The resources in these plans are yours and yours alone. You don’t have to worry about anyone else taking your share.

SSD storage

Every one of these plans comes with SSD NVMe storage, to ensure quicker loading times – up to three times faster than normal SSDs.

The three most frequently asked questions about our new VPS offering

How technical do you need to be to have VPS hosting?

You’ll get the most out of these plans if you know your way around a server. If you’re well-versed in SSH commands, you can use them for server admin, too.

If you’re looking for high power hosting but feel like the technical side of a VPS is too much, take a look at our Business Hosting packages, instead. These come with cPanel included, so you can manage your hosting admin through a graphical interface.

How long does it take to set up a VPS?

Usually, we will have your VPS up and running within 24 hours.
